Output c84fc9e7f5037526363c77111c3516d651970c57bb8fd87ea9128a90e8b1220e:14

value
577905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b250cba01dc4d523e9f4b672efe8e3dd69e728a OP_EQUAL
address
34AYYyvz2WSGYkpRujJSK8KuPBHDYf93B3
transaction
c84fc9e7f5037526363c77111c3516d651970c57bb8fd87ea9128a90e8b1220e
spent
true